Simon Sneath – Artist Statement
I work with stoneware, porcelain and coarse crank clays using throwing and slab building techniques. My starting points are generally drawings or 3D sketches. Maquettes follow to explore form, scale, texture, mechanical strength etc. before I make the final piece.
My plates, jars and constructions are “one off” items while the lanterns, with their origins in a visit to Japan, are part of an ongoing repeat series.
I make everything with an intended sense of peace and tranquility and I hope those who view my work will see something of these qualities and connect with it in their own way.
